Sphere Entertainment Co.
A company behind the Sphere, the giant glowing ball-shaped Las Vegas arena wrapped in a huge LED screen that hosts concerts, original shows like The Wizard of Oz at Sphere, and brand events. Born from the Madison Square Garden family, it spun off in 2020 and again in 2023 to become its own business, alongside MSG Networks, which broadcasts New York Knicks and Rangers games. Its name is simply its shape—the building is literally a sphere.

Select a row to see that insider’s individual transactions. Sum of the holdings confirmed in the 12 months before this insider's last filing. A Form 4 reports a holding per line — held directly, or through a named trust, partnership or foundation, and in each share class separately — never a person’s total. Lines not restated in that time are left out and shown apart: an active filer restates what they still hold, so a line they did not restate is more often an entity since renamed, whose shares a successor line reports too. An amber marker means some were left out.
Net open-market activity over the last 3 years: +173.4K shares. Grants, option exercises and tax withholding are excluded — they are compensation mechanics, not decisions to buy or sell.
